Publisher's summary

The real stories behind the scenery of America’s national parks.

For 12 years, Andrea Lankford lived in the biggest, most impressive national parks in the world, working a job she loved. She chaperoned baby sea turtles on their journey to sea. She pursued bad guys on her galloping patrol horse. She jumped into rescue helicopters bound for the heart of the Grand Canyon. She won arguments with bears. She slept with a few too many rattlesnakes.

Hell yeah, it was the best job in the world! Fortunately, Andrea survived it.

In this graphic and yet surprisingly funny account of her and others’ extraordinary careers, Lankford unveils a world in which park rangers struggle to maintain their idealism in the face of death, disillusionment, and the loss of a comrade killed while holding that thin green line between protecting the park from the people, the people from the park, and the people from each other. Ranger Confidential is the story behind the scenery of the nation’s crown jewels - Yosemite, Grand Canyon, Yellowstone, Great Smokies, Denali. In these iconic landscapes, where nature and humanity constantly collide, scenery can be as cruel as it is redemptive.

Truthful accounts

Sometimes when listening to people describe their experiences, I feel they try & focus on mostly the positives omitting the trials/negatives. This book goes there. None of the difficulties of being a ranger were avoided or omitted to make it more palatable for the audience. Others have complained that this made the book difficult to enjoy, but I feel the opposite. It was refreshing to hear the truth of this ranger’s experiences (& that of her friends). I have been in the backcountry of some of the places described to conduct research & I can’t imagine working there daily like they do. When I tell people about Alaska all they want to talk about was how cool my experiences must’ve been, but the reality is that it’s a truly wild place with real threats all around (and I hope it stays that way for the record). Hearing about the life & work of Ranger Kale Schaffer was incredible and I think the author did a great job telling his (& Mary’s) stories. I truly felt like I knew them myself by the end of the book. I would highly recommend this to anyone, but especially to anyone considering a career in the NPS.
